Drew Bogner, Ph.D. graduated from Kansas Newman College in 1979, returned to Newman as a faculty member in 1987, and served as provost from 1991 to 2000. He is now president of Molloy College in Rockville Centre, N.Y., and has served as chair of the NCAA Division II Presidents Council since 2009. In the interview that follows, Bogner speaks on the rationale and value of the DII “Life in the Balance” initiative, and his role in its creation.

Some brothers do a lot of things together. Then there are the Gallaghers. “Brothers in blood, brothers in arms,” is how Joseph and Patrick Gallagher describe their relationship. That’s because they grew up together in Wichita and then served their country together, each completing two tours of duty in Iraq in the Marine Corps. They were even stationed together for a short time upon returning home. Now, they study together, with Joe pursuing a degree in radiologic technology and Patrick working on a degree in communication at Newman University.
